Output 04b78de11b892478ac93f50a158a4be337cfbe731d9cd6b0a1c6a3e425376aea:7

value
2055531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17d99240a6439b2a82c10bba39ff9ad4e4ce2ddd OP_EQUAL
address
33s875HdnboUFw1KDDZG8axNSkg44znNiL
transaction
04b78de11b892478ac93f50a158a4be337cfbe731d9cd6b0a1c6a3e425376aea
confirmations
114627
spent
true